Linda Hammons

Linda Sue Hammons, 72, of Ronceverte, passed away Thursday, November 23, 2023, at Seneca Trail Healthcare Center.

Born July 25, 1951, in Ronceverte, she was a daughter of the late Luther and Mildred Baker Wykle.

In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by a brother, Kenny Wykle; and sister, Bonnie Bowyer.

She is survived by her husband, Danny Hammons; son, Jamey Hammons; daughters, Jennifer McCallister (Adam), and Stacy Hammons; brother, Bobby Wykle (Gwen); sister, Patty Smith; grandchildren, Lance, Mary, Noah and Kolin Hammons, Josh Holliday, Sarah Spurlock, Meghan and Kendra McCallister, Destiny, Kyley, Zachery, Nadaley, Coby and Wesley Hamrick; and several nieces and nephews.

Graveside service was held Monday, November 27, 2023, in the Mausoleum of Greenbrier Memorial Gardens in Lewisburg, with Pastor Gary Baker officiating.

An online guestbook can be signed at www.morganfh.net

Arrangements by Morgan Funeral Home, Lewisburg.
